Descripción de cómo se determinan los anchos de columna en Excel

Resumen

El ancho de columna estándar en Microsoft Excel 2000 es de 8,43 caracteres; sin embargo, el ancho real que se ve en la pantalla varía, dependiendo del ancho de la fuente definida para el estilo Normal del libro. Cambiar la fuente predeterminada también cambia el ancho de columna. Este comportamiento se produce debido a la forma en que Excel almacena la información de ancho de columna para fuentes individuales. En este artículo se describe cómo se determinan los anchos de columna.

Más información

Excel comienza con un ancho predeterminado de 8 caracteres y lo traduce en un número determinado de píxeles, dependiendo de la fuente de estilo Normal. A continuación, redondea este número hasta el múltiplo más cercano de 8 píxeles, de modo que el desplazamiento entre columnas y filas sea más rápido. El ancho de píxel se almacena internamente en Excel para posicionar los datos en la pantalla. El número que se ve en el cuadro de diálogo Ancho de columna es el ancho de píxel retranslatado en unidades de caracteres (en función de la fuente Normal) para mostrar.

Un ancho de columna de 8,43 significa que 8,43 de los caracteres de la fuente predeterminada caben en una celda. La fuente predeterminada de la hoja de cálculo es la fuente que se asigna al estilo Normal. Excel 2000 usa una fuente predeterminada de fábrica de Arial 10.

Nota:

El cambio de PPP de impresora puede afectar a las métricas de fuente y puede ajustar el ancho de columna. Microsoft Office Excel 2007 usa un tema predeterminado denominado Office. Este tema predeterminado tiene Cambria como fuente de encabezado predeterminada y Calibri 11 como fuente de cuerpo predeterminada.

Para determinar la fuente predeterminada en la hoja de cálculo, siga estos pasos:

  1. En el menú Formato, haga clic en Estilo.
  2. Lea la fuente que aparece junto a la casilla Fuente.

Para cambiar la fuente predeterminada, siga estos pasos:

  1. En el menú Formato, haga clic en Estilo.
  2. Haga clic en Modificar.
  3. En la pestaña Fuente, seleccione la fuente, el estilo y el tamaño que desee.
  4. Haga clic en Aceptar.

Para cambiar la fuente predeterminada en Excel 2007, siga estos pasos:

  1. En la pestaña Diseño de página , en el grupo Temas , haga clic en Fuentes.
  2. Haga clic en Crear nuevas fuentes de tema.
  3. En los cuadros Fuente de encabezado y Fuente de cuerpo , seleccione las fuentes que desee. utilizar.
  4. En el cuadro Con nombre , escriba Office para reemplazar la plantilla predeterminada.
  5. Haga clic en Guardar.

Si la fuente predeterminada es una fuente no proporcional (ancho fijo), como Courier, 8,43 caracteres de cualquier tipo (números o letras) caben en una celda con un ancho de columna de 8,43 porque todos los caracteres courier tienen el mismo ancho. Si la fuente es una fuente proporcional, como Arial, los enteros de 8,43 (números como 0, 1, 2, etc.) caben en una celda con un ancho de columna de 8,43. Esto se debe a que los números están espaciados fijamente con la mayoría de las fuentes proporcionales. Sin embargo, dado que las letras no están espaciados fijamente con fuentes proporcionales, caben más caracteres "i" y caben menos caracteres "w".

Al cambiar el ancho de una columna a un número fraccionario, el ancho de columna puede establecerse en un número diferente en función de la fuente utilizada en el estilo Normal. Por ejemplo, con una fuente de estilo Normal de Arial, si intenta cambiar el ancho de una columna a 8,5, la columna se establece en 8,57 o 65 píxeles. Este comportamiento se produce debido a la traducción de caracteres de fuente a unidades de píxel. No se pueden mostrar unidades de píxel fraccionarias; por lo tanto, el ancho de columna se redondea al número más cercano que da como resultado una unidad de píxel completa.

Ejemplo de comportamiento de ancho de columna

  1. En un nuevo libro de Excel, seleccione la celda A1.

  2. En el menú Formato, seleccione Columna y, a continuación, haga clic en Ancho.

  3. En el cuadro Ancho de columna, escriba 10 (75 píxeles de ancho) y, a continuación, haga clic en Aceptar.

  4. En el menú Formato, haga clic en Estiloy, a continuación, compruebe que la fuente predeterminada está establecida correctamente en Arial 10.

  5. En la celda A1, escriba 1234567890.

    Nota:

    Las letras encajan perfectamente en la celda y el ancho de la columna sigue siendo de 10 (75 píxeles de ancho).

  6. En el menú Formato, haga clic en Estilo.

  7. Haga clic en Modificar.

  8. En la pestaña Fuente, cambie la fuente a Courier New y haga clic en Aceptar dos veces. Tenga en cuenta que el cuadro Ancho de columna se actualiza automáticamente para adaptarse a la nueva fuente y que el número de la celda todavía se ajusta, aunque el ancho de columna sigue siendo 10, pero ha aumentado a 85 píxeles de ancho.

Comportamiento del ancho de columna en Excel 2007

Para establecer el ancho de columna en Excel 2007, siga estos pasos:

  1. En la primera columna, haga clic en A para seleccionar la columna y, a continuación, haga clic con el botón derecho y seleccione Ancho de columna.
  2. Escriba el ancho que desee para la columna.
  3. Haga clic en Aceptar.

El comportamiento del ancho de columna en Excel 2007 es el mismo que el indicado anteriormente. Si cambia las fuentes después de haber establecido el ancho, se ajustará para el ancho de píxel de las nuevas fuentes.